Clarke JClarke@Rose.net June 17, 2004, 12:37 pm Source: Scanned from original in my possession Photo can be seen at: http://www.usgwarchives.net/ga/morgan/photos/ph1212richterb.jpg Image file size: 85.6 Kb A caption is included on the potograph but they are: Front Row (left, seated) Professor Charles W. RICHTER, Jr. (1837-1907) who was permanently disabled on 2 Jul 1863 at Gettysburg as a member of the 3rd GA. Married Mary Louise HUNTER of Greensboro, Greene County, GA. Front Row (right, seated) Lt. Arthur Potter RICHTER (1844-1928) of Madison who served in the 5th GA VIR. Married Francis Cornelia FIELDING of Madison. Back Row (left, standing) John C. RICHTER, Sr. (1848-1907) who served in Capers Battalion, "Georgia Cadets" during the Civil War. Married Alice E. DANIEL of Jefferson County, GA. (John was my grandfather) Back Row (right, standing) Martin L. "Mat" RICHTER, Sr. (1846-1924), like John he also served in Capers Battalion, "Georgia Cadets" during the Civil War. He married Hallie Elise RIVERS of James Island, SC. Additional Comments: Photo has been compressed/resized for use in the USGenWeb Archives.
